2005 Jeep Wrangler vs. 2012 Subaru Forester
To start off, 2012 Subaru Forester is newer by 7 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 2005 Jeep Wrangler.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 2005 Jeep Wrangler would be higher. At 2,500 cc (4 cylinders), 2012 Subaru Forester is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2005 Jeep Wrangler (148 HP @ 5200 RPM) has 3 more horse power than 2012 Subaru Forester. (145 HP @ 3600 RPM). In normal driving conditions, 2005 Jeep Wrangler should accelerate faster than 2012 Subaru Forester.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 2012 Subaru Forester weights approximately 35 kg more than 2005 Jeep Wrangler.
With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 2012 Subaru Forester (350 Nm @ 1600 RPM) has 135 more torque (in Nm) than 2005 Jeep Wrangler. (215 Nm @ 4000 RPM). This means 2012 Subaru Forester will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 2005 Jeep Wrangler.
Compare all specifications:
2005 Jeep Wrangler | 2012 Subaru Forester | |
Make | Jeep | Subaru |
Model | Wrangler | Forester |
Year Released | 2005 | 2012 |
Body Type | SUV | SUV |
Engine Position | Front | Front |
Engine Size | 2429 cc | 2500 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 4 cylinders | 4 cylinders |
Engine Type | in-line | boxer |
Horse Power | 148 HP | 145 HP |
Engine RPM | 5200 RPM | 3600 RPM |
Torque | 215 Nm | 350 Nm |
Torque RPM | 4000 RPM | 1600 RPM |
Fuel Type | Gasoline - Premium | Diesel |
Top Speed | 164 km/hour | 187 km/hour |
Acceleration 0-100mph | 11.9 seconds | 10.3 seconds |
Drive Type | 4WD | AWD |
Transmission Type | Manual | Manual |
Number of Seats | 4 seats | 5 seats |
Number of Doors | 3 doors | 5 doors |
Vehicle Weight | 1505 kg | 1540 kg |
Vehicle Length | 3890 mm | 4559 mm |
Vehicle Width | 1750 mm | 1781 mm |
Vehicle Height | 1940 mm | 1674 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 2380 mm | 2616 mm |
Fuel Consumption Overall | 10.4 L/100km | 5.9 L/100km |
Fuel Tank Capacity | 72 L | 64 L |
